CASTLECLIFF TOWN BOARD.

MONTHLY MEETING. Tbe ordinary meeting of t&e Casfcieotiff Town Board was held on Tuesday, tbe chairman (Mr C. Cresswell) presiding. The following were aJteo present? Commissioners R. G. Firth, F. G\« Newcombe, J. H. Paesoaore, attd B* Dunkley. WORKS COMMITTEE REPORT. On the motion of Cmr. Passmora, eeo* onded by Cmr. Firth, ■ the Committee report, which contained the following, was adopted: In regard to the application of Messrs Beadle and McCarthy to hare the sandbank removed from the front of their sections in Maitai Street, it was recommended that on the owners undertaking to have the sand removed clear to the road line and proper batters formed for the prevention of farther drift to the satisfaction of tbe foreman, the Board should agree to contribute the sum of <£6 towards the cost of the work. In respect of a similar application by Mr V. E. Manson, it was re<sommendea that the Board should undertake tbrt work, provided that Mr Manson &a«i the adjoining section owners agree trt contribute towards the cost of same and to clay the surface of their seo&Hlg so as to prevent further drift of sawti on to the roadway. MISCELLANEOUS MATTERS. It, was decided to reply to a request made by the Efficiency Board for information dealing with any matte*** which would* tend to increased effioieaMy! in the district at the present tame'and in the future, th&t the Board was «nis doing maintenance work. Comiß. Passmore and Dunkley '•era appointed delegates to confer with otheaJ local bodies for making arraagemettto for a suitable programme to be cawied out on Anzac Day, April 25. A letter was received from the Gobville Town Board stating that it badj been decided to hold over the question of the establishment of a pound. Also that the delegates appointed to oetosider the matter of the proposed owetery would report at a later date. It was resolved to take no for*** action in the matter of an offer of certain land by Mr G. Sanders for & road* The foreman was instructed to aaO«fftain the cost of removing the sandbaaia at the comer of Heads Road and Cram Street and levelling off the top of fim section. Accounts amounting to £2K 14s "wwei prosed for pagonent. The bwnk hafeNMe showed dr. .£367 3s 3d. The foreman reported that vnxicmM streets h*d been repaired where required, and portions of Cornfoot SttoMQ jbki Ocas Stm* had been wetaUf*.
